A few more links of interest:
--- Brian Dohn of the LA Daily News caught up with E.J. Woods, the UCLA commit who has reopened his recruitment and is now also considering UW (apparently the only UCLA commit now considering the Huskies, as far as I can tell). The item on Woods is a couple down. As you can see, some pretty heavy-hitters on Woods' list now as he also says he's looking at Ohio State, LSU and Colorado along with UCLA and UW.
--- UTEP AD Bob Stull says he hasn't been contacted about the Washington job and has no comment since they haven't. But this doesn't really mean much. A UW spokesman said the school will likely form a search committee, which won't happen until next year, so the school hasn't even gotten close to the point where it would start contacting anyone. Could be a month or two before that happens. So don't figure on a lot of news on the AD front for a while.
--- Ken Goe at the Oregonian has an interesting (and probably unpopular to this audience) take on what has happened at UW the last few years. Sure a lot of you won't like Ken's views on this, but he is as good and respected and fair a writer as there is in this business.
--- May not be much recruiting news for a while, either, as this is now a dead period (see calender here) which runs through Jan. 3. That means coaches are limited to one call per week to recruits, with no personal contact. Here's an old, but good, explainer of the dead period.
